Add debug messages for nvme/fcp resource allocation.

The xri resources are split into pools for NVME and FCP IO when NVME is
enabled. There was not message in the log that identified this allocation.

Added debug message to log XRI split.

Signed-off-by: Dick Kennedy <dick.kennedy@broadcom.com>
Signed-off-by: James Smart <james.smart@broadcom.com>
Reviewed-by: Johannes Thumshirn <jthumshirn@suse.de>
This commit is contained in:
James Smart 2017-04-21 16:04:49 -07:00 committed by Christoph Hellwig
parent c154e750d3
commit e8c0a77935
1 changed files with 6 additions and 0 deletions

View File

@ -3508,6 +3508,12 @@ lpfc_sli4_scsi_sgl_update(struct lpfc_hba *phba)
spin_unlock(&phba->scsi_buf_list_put_lock);
spin_unlock_irq(&phba->scsi_buf_list_get_lock);
lpfc_printf_log(phba, KERN_INFO, LOG_SLI,
"6060 Current allocated SCSI xri-sgl count:%d, "
"maximum SCSI xri count:%d (split:%d)\n",
phba->sli4_hba.scsi_xri_cnt,
phba->sli4_hba.scsi_xri_max, phba->cfg_xri_split);
if (phba->sli4_hba.scsi_xri_cnt > phba->sli4_hba.scsi_xri_max) {
/* max scsi xri shrinked below the allocated scsi buffers */
scsi_xri_cnt = phba->sli4_hba.scsi_xri_cnt -